Treebank Statistics: UD_Hausa-NorthernAutogramm: POS Tags: NUM
There are 18 NUM lemmas (2%), 19 NUM types (1%) and 106 NUM tokens (1%).
Out of 16 observed tags, the rank of NUM is: 12 in number of lemmas, 15 in number of types and 14 in number of tokens.
The 10 most frequent NUM lemmas: biyu, gùdaː, goːmà, ukkù, shiddà, ɗai, ɗàriː, tàlàːtin, ɗaya, huɗu
The 10 most frequent NUM types: buy, gùdaː, goːmà, ukkù, ɗai, shiddà, ɗàriː, tàlàːtin, huɗu, bakwài
The 10 most frequent ambiguous lemmas: biyu (NUM 20, NOUN 1), gùdaː (NUM 16, NOUN 4), ɗai (NUM 6, ADV 4), ɗaya (NUM 5, ADV 1), bakwài (NUM 3, NOUN 1), shâː (ADP 14, VERB 4, NUM 1)
The 10 most frequent ambiguous types: buy (NUM 17, NOUN 1), gùdaː (NUM 16, NOUN 1), ɗai (NUM 10, ADV 5), bakwài (NUM 3, NOUN 1), shâː (ADP 14, VERB 4, NUM 1), tarà (VERB 3, NUM 1)

Morphology
The form / lemma ratio of NUM is 1.055556 (the average of all parts of speech is 1.634085).
The 1st highest number of forms (2) was observed with the lemma “biyu”: biyu, buy.
The 2nd highest number of forms (2) was observed with the lemma “ɗaya”: ɗai, ɗay.
The 3rd highest number of forms (1) was observed with the lemma “bakwài”: bakwài.
NUM occurs with 2 features: Gender (4; 4% instances), Definite (2; 2% instances)
NUM occurs with 3 feature-value pairs: Definite=Cons, Gender=Fem, Gender=Masc
NUM occurs with 4 feature combinations.
The most frequent feature combination is _ (102 tokens).
Examples: gùdaː, buy, goːmà, ukkù, ɗai, shiddà, ɗàriː, tàlàːtin, huɗu, bakwài
Relations
NUM nodes are attached to their parents using 13 different relations: nummod (59; 56% instances), nmod (20; 19% instances), advcl (4; 4% instances), conj (4; 4% instances), xcomp (4; 4% instances), dislocated (3; 3% instances), obl:arg (3; 3% instances), flat (2; 2% instances), nsubj (2; 2% instances), obj (2; 2% instances), ccomp (1; 1% instances), obl:mod (1; 1% instances), root (1; 1% instances)
Parents of NUM nodes belong to 7 different parts of speech: NOUN (55; 52% instances), VERB (21; 20% instances), NUM (20; 19% instances), PRON (4; 4% instances), AUX (3; 3% instances), PART (2; 2% instances), (1; 1% instances)
59 (56%) NUM nodes are leaves.
35 (33%) NUM nodes have one child.
6 (6%) NUM nodes have two children.
6 (6%) NUM nodes have three or more children.
The highest child degree of a NUM node is 10.
Children of NUM nodes are attached using 17 different relations: case (21; 27% instances), nmod (15; 19% instances), punct (7; 9% instances), advmod (5; 6% instances), nsubj (5; 6% instances), conj (4; 5% instances), dislocated (4; 5% instances), cop (3; 4% instances), flat (3; 4% instances), obl:mod (3; 4% instances), mark (2; 3% instances), aux (1; 1% instances), cc (1; 1% instances), ccomp (1; 1% instances), dep (1; 1% instances), det (1; 1% instances), discourse (1; 1% instances)
Children of NUM nodes belong to 13 different parts of speech: NUM (20; 26% instances), ADP (17; 22% instances), PRON (8; 10% instances), PUNCT (7; 9% instances), NOUN (5; 6% instances), PART (5; 6% instances), AUX (4; 5% instances), ADV (3; 4% instances), SCONJ (3; 4% instances), CCONJ (2; 3% instances), VERB (2; 3% instances), DET (1; 1% instances), INTJ (1; 1% instances)
